WVUH West Virginia University Hospitals is seeking an outpatient scheduling and registration specialist to handle scheduling, cancellations, and registrations for ambulatory clinics. You will collect necessary information, communicate with patients, and coordinate with physicians and staff to ensure timely appointments.
The role requires a high school diploma, background check, and the ability to manage multiple tasks in a standard office environment.
Responsible for scheduling, cancelling, rescheduling and registering of outpatient visits and procedures for multiple ambulatory clinics, by collecting all necessary information for schedule and registration preparation.
